Located in the heart of the Main Line and just a few miles outside Center City Philadelphia, Narberth PA is a charming and unique borough nestled inside Lower Merion Township easily accessible by car, train, bus, and bike. Stop by. You'll love it here.
Via SEPTA: The Narberth Train Station is on the Paoli/Thorndale Line, and the Route 44 Bus stops in Narberth.
Via Bicycle: Contact the Narberth Cycling Club for help finding the best route. Driving: Narberth is accessible from Montgomery, Bowman, and Wynnewood Avenues. Lancaster Ave and City Ave are just a few blocks away. Parking: 2-hour non-metered parking and 1-, 2-, 5-, and 10-hour metered parking is available near downtown Narberth. Parking meters are in effect 9am - 6pm Monday through Saturday and take quarters only. |
